Types Of Materials Used for Retaining Walls

When considering retaining walls in Carbrook, the choice of materials is crucial. Each option brings its own aesthetic and functional benefits. Concrete blocks are a popular choice due to their durability and versatility. They can be molded into various shapes and sizes, allowing for creative designs that fit any landscape. Natural stone offers a timeless appeal. Its organic look blends seamlessly with outdoor settings while providing strength against soil erosion.

Timber is another viable material, particularly for those seeking a rustic vibe. Treated timber can withstand moisture but may require regular maintenance to ensure longevity. Gabion walls combine wire cages filled with rocks or stones. This modern approach not only supports earth but also enhances drainage around the structure. Brick pavers present an elegant appearance while offering great structural integrity. Their variety of colors allows homeowners to customize aesthetics easily without sacrificing function.

Tips For Proper Drainage in Retaining Walls Carindale

Proper drainage is essential for the longevity of Retaining Walls Carindale. Without it, water pressure can build up behind the wall, leading to potential collapse. Installing weep holes at regular intervals allows excess water to escape. These small openings help reduce hydrostatic pressure and keep your wall stable.

Another effective method is using gravel backfill. This material encourages drainage while providing structural support. A well-drained area behind your retaining wall promotes better soil health and reduces erosion. Consider adding a perforated drain pipe at the base of the wall, directing water away from your foundation. This proactive measure further enhances stability. Regular maintenance is key as well; check for blockages or sediment buildup that could hinder flow over time. Keeping an eye on these elements ensures both functionality and durability in your landscape design.

How long do retaining walls typically last?
With proper installation and maintenance, most retaining walls can last anywhere from 30 to 50 years. The choice of materials plays a significant role in their longevity.
